Hello, and welcome! My name is Jessie, and I’m a passionate educator with 8 years of diverse teaching experience and a deep commitment to helping students succeed.
With a Bachelor’s degree in Elementary Education and teaching licenses in Elementary and Secondary education, I began my career as a student teacher in 2nd grade before moving into a full-time 5th-grade teaching role, which I held for 6 years. This experience taught me how to support students academically and emotionally during critical years of their growth.
Later, as a substitute teacher, I had the opportunity to teach kindergarten through 9th grade. This role allowed me to adapt my teaching to a variety of ages and learning needs, giving me valuable insight into each stage of a student's journey. I also work with adult learners striving to complete their GED or high school credits, which has been incredibly rewarding.
In addition, I’ve led school programs designed to support students whose first language isn’t English, helping them to feel more comfortable and confident in their studies. I know how important it is to adapt lessons for English Language Learners and make learning accessible and enjoyable.
My teaching style is interactive, flexible, and creative. I believe learning should be meaningful and fun, and I love helping students of all ages see that they’re capable of doing hard things.
